Understanding the Way ChatGPT Forms Answers


To understand how to rank in ChatGPT answers, businesses must first understand that conversational AI does not work in the same way as traditional search engines. It aims to provide valuable, direct, and context-aware responses. It may prefer content that appears well explained, reliable across sources, authoritative, and aligned with the user’s question. This makes clarity highly important. If a brand’s content is unclear, not detailed enough, outdated, or badly organised, AI systems may find it difficult to recognise it as a reliable answer source.

Strong AI visibility usually comes from several signals supporting each other. These include detailed topic coverage, brand consistency, expert content, third-party mentions, organised explanations, common user questions, and accurate service explanation. A business must create clear signals for AI systems to understand what it does and why it matters. The more reliable and well-supported the information is across different trusted content environments, the stronger the likelihood of being included in AI-led answers.

The Purpose of an AI Search Ranking Tool


An AI search performance tool helps businesses understand how they appear across AI-driven discovery channels. Instead of only tracking standard keyword positions, such a tool may help reveal whether a brand is being shown in AI-generated answers, which topics are associated with the brand, what competitors are visible for related prompts, and where content gaps exist. This gives businesses a clearer view of their AI search performance.

A useful AI search visibility tool can also help content teams understand which questions users are likely to ask. These may include comparison questions, problem-solving queries, product research prompts, nearby service searches, and niche-specific questions. By studying these patterns, businesses can develop content that answers real user needs. The goal is not to game AI results, but to become a truly helpful and recognisable source within a specific topic area.

Why Entity Building Matters


Entity optimisation means making a brand, service, product, or topic clearly understandable as a recognised concept. For AI search, this is especially important. If a business wants to be associated with AI search ranking tool an AI search platform, AI visibility, or ranking in ChatGPT answers, its content should regularly describe these areas. The brand should have a well-defined identity, a defined purpose, and strong topic alignment.

Entity optimisation also involves removing unclear signals. A business should use consistent names, brand explanations, topic categories, and solution details. When information is spread out or confusing, AI systems may not reliably associate the brand with a specific search intent. When the information is structured and repeated naturally across relevant content, the connection becomes stronger.

Monitoring Competitors in AI Responses


Competitor tracking is another reason businesses use an AI search ranking tool. In traditional search, companies monitor keyword rankings. In AI search, they may need to track which brands show up in AI results, what language is used to explain them, what topics they dominate, and where they are not visible. This type of analysis can reveal valuable opportunities.

For example, if competitors are appearing for prompts related to AI visibility but a business is not, the issue may be thin topic coverage, poor topic coverage, low brand recognition, or confusing brand positioning. By reviewing these gaps, the business can improve its content strategy and build stronger authority in the areas that matter most.
